MPC 909

MPC 909 is a 2009 tank barge. The Coast Guard has recorded 22 inspections since 2009, most recently in April 2026, along with 1 deficiency.

Deficiency record · 1

02 - Structural Conditions › N/A - No Subsystem › Other (Structural condition)
Issued 28 January 2019 Resolved
There is an approx 10' x 5" inset in the port side deck knuckle approx mid ship of barge.
Action required: 50 - Rectify deficiencies w/in 30 days
Resolved 5 April 2019
Resolution: Repaired Hull plate as above required
